# SYNOPSIS 📖
**What can I do with this?** This image will run BIND9 DNS server precompiled for large installations and maximum performance. It also offers three operating modes: Master, Slave and Resolver set via **command: ["mode"]**.

### There is no latest tag, what am I supposed to do about updates?
It is of my opinion that the ```:latest``` tag is super dangerous. Many times, Ive introduced **breaking** changes to my images. This would have messed up everything for some people. If you dont want to change the tag to the latest [semver](https://semver.org/), simply use the short versions of [semver](https://semver.org/). Instead of using ```:9.18.36``` you can use ```:9``` or ```:9.18```. Since on each new version these tags are updated to the latest version of the software, using them is identical to using ```:latest``` but at least fixed to a major or minor version.
